Output 66ed485988e86d350d1cd4234ec1352522909caebf8531c28c5560f82119576e:2

value
1049484720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4dc0a603eb29b5c010a64f0bbca8eccd208157 OP_EQUAL
address
3EPazYnkCJqsFAxHuLFb7TZ3Z6nNdNqMqr
transaction
66ed485988e86d350d1cd4234ec1352522909caebf8531c28c5560f82119576e
confirmations
438811
spent
true